[Studies on phloroglucinol derivatives of Dryopteris fragrans L]

Abstract
Objective:
To study the phloroglucinol derivatives of Dryopteris fragrans.
Methods:
Isolation and purification were carried out on repeated silica gel, Sephadex LH-20 column chromatography and prepare HPLC. The structures of the compounds were determined by physicochemical properties and spectral analysis.
Results:
Four compounds were isolated and identified as aspidin PB (I), dryofragin (II), aspidinol (III), aspidin BB (IV).
Conclusion:
Compounds IV is isolated from this plant for the first time.
